Abstract :
Tools selection that is made artificially in manufacturing process often takes the experts much time and such experience is difficult to be shared. In this overview, the general tools selection process is summarized, and the methodologies, including based-rules method and other preventative algorithms, are introduced according to their applicable conditions. A practical intelligent system and a multi-hierarchy grey selection model are given to show the process of the intelligent tools selection and to verify its efficiency in manufacturing production.
